A Streetcar Named Desire (Oct. 16-19)

Overview: One of the most admired plays of its time, it concerns the mental and moral disintegration and ultimate ruin of Blanche DuBois, a former Southern belle. The play reveals to the very depths the character whose life has been undermined by her romantic illusions, which lead her to reject—so far as possible—the realities of life with which she is faced and which she consistently ignores. The pressure brought to bear upon her by her sister, with whom she goes to live in New Orleans, intensified by the earthy and extremely “normal” young husband, Stanley Kowalski, leads to a revelation of Blanche’s tragic self-delusion and, in the end, to madness. RATED PG-13
